The second bomb alert at the Romanian Naval Authority in Constanta within 24 hours. The maneuvers of the ships have been temporarily suspended.

A new bomb threat was reported at the headquarters of the Romanian Naval Authority (ANR) in the Port of Constanța, causing the evacuation of employees and the temporary suspension of the entry and exit maneuvers of ships from the port, starting at 12:00.


The threat message, similar to the one received 24 hours earlier, was sent to an ANR employee and indicated that several bombs might be placed in the building.


Police and firefighters intervened on-site, and the prefect of Constanța County stated that, although the alert was false, all security measures were followed. Employees were evacuated for 20 minutes, and operations in the port were suspended to ensure safety.


Authorities suspect that these alerts are part of a wave of hybrid threats, and anti-terror protocols are being strictly followed.
